#fe02af h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#fe02af is composed of 99.6% red, 0.8%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 31.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 318.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#fe02af color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#fd005f.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

● #fe02af color description : Vivid pink.
The hexadecimal color #fe02af has RGB values of R:254, G:2,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.31, K:0. Its decimal value is 16646831.
